## Further reading

The Ledgerline payments service has a known set of flaky integration tests, mostly around the sandbox settlement mock timing out under parallel runs. Do not blindly retry CI more than twice; tag the failure instead. The quarantine list is reviewed weekly by the Harkness squad. Background on root causes, the quarantine process, and how to mark a test flaky are documented on the internal page.

wiki page, tahaf-tajog: https://jira.ordindyn.corp/pipeline

Onboarding note for the Ledgerpane admin table: bulk edits are applied through the batcher service, not directly against the database. Select rows, choose an action, and the batcher stages changes in a pending set you can review before commit. Edits over 500 rows require a second approver — this is enforced server-side, so don't try to chunk around it. To run the batcher locally you need the staging write credential, which goes in your .env as the next line.

secret setting of bahip-kagag: RELAY_SECRET3=c83

# Break-Glass: Catalog Cache Invalidation

Scope: the Pinrow product catalog at Veldstone Retail. If stale prices persist after a purge and the Hollowmere invalidation queue is wedged, use break-glass to flush the edge tier directly. Contractors: get verbal sign-off from the catalog lead first. Steps: open the Hollowmere admin shell, select emergency-flush, confirm the tenant, and run it once — repeated flushes thrash the origin. Access is logged and expires after 20 minutes. Unseal the admin shell with the passphrase below.

recovery phrase for kahop-tajog: istix-casvan

TICKET BRC-4412: Stale-branch cleanup bot (Sweepling) failing signature verification on its own commits since Tuesday's runner image bump. All deletions blocked, which is correct behavior. Root cause: the bot's signing identity was not migrated to the new runner. No tampering indicators found in audit logs. To unblock, re-provision the bot with the key below.

signing key of bagap-yawep = bky13_TbfT6ZMUoGJo2